public class matrixmult {

  public static void main(String argv[]) {
    if (argv.length!=1) {
      System.err.println("Need one argument.");
      System.exit(1);
    }
    int n=Integer.decode(argv[0]).intValue();
    double[][] M = new double[n][n];
    for (int i=0; i<n; i++) {
      for (int j=0; j<n; j++) {
	M[i][j]=i+j+2.5;
      }
    }
    double r=0;
    for (int i=0; i<n; i++) {
      for (int j=0; j<n; j++) {
	for (int k=0; k<n; k++) {
	  r=r+M[i][k]*M[k][j];
	}
      }
    }
    System.out.println(r);
  }

}

